Portland’s mix of pedestrians, cyclists, seasonal visitors, and dense roadways can make part-failure cases uniquely stressful. After a crash, it’s common for the vehicle to be towed, repaired quickly, and cleared from the scene—often before anyone thinks about preservation.
In Portland, we also frequently see:
- Short time windows for documentation when vehicles are repaired before diagnostic data is captured.
- Conflicting accounts when multiple people witnessed the crash but remember details differently.
- Insurance pressure during peak schedules, when adjusters push for recorded statements or quick settlement before injuries stabilize.
Those realities matter because defective auto part claims are evidence-driven. What’s missing early can become the whole dispute later.
